Berlin International College is a private Studienkolleg. We prepare international students without a direct university entrance qualification (HZB) in language and subject-specific courses, enabling them to study at German universities. For the German language courses accompanying our Bachelor Prep Program 2026/2027 (T-Kurs and W-Kurs), we are looking for teachers of German as a foreign language at levels A1 and A2.
You will teach German from beginner level up to A2, and you will prepare and conduct the internal BIC level test at the end of each course. The official A1 and A2 examinations are taken externally at a licensed telc examination centre and are not part of the course.
Timeframe: • A1 course: 17.11.2026 – 30.01.2027 • A2 course: 02.02.2027 – 29.05.2027
Class times: • Tuesdays and Thursdays in blocks of 90 min (1 block = 2 teaching units of 45 min each) • Selected Saturdays with 4–6 teaching units • Intensive weeks Monday to Thursday in December, March and April with 6 teaching units per day
Mode of classes: on site in Berlin, online teaching possible • Language of instruction: German
